In case of concrete pavement, why is requirement of 95% by mass of quartz grains are specified in contract?
Answer In universal Specification of Civil Engineering, in Clause 10.09 it states "Fine aggregate for concrete shall be usual river-deposited sand consisting of at least 95 percent by mass of quartz grains". Aim of such requirement is to control excellence of river sand. As quartz is a strong and hard material, using a far above the ground percentage of quartz in aggregates of concrete is able to enhance strength and durability of surface texture of concrete carriageway.
In adding, such specification needs a high percentage of quartz content, thereby dropping the probability of being there of impurities as shell.
